A Short Term Lease Apartments in Dacre Banks is a legal contract that indicates that a lessee will give services or financial damages to a lessor in exchange for temporary possession (not ownership) of property. Individuals and businesses may use short term leases for virtually any property. In most cases, a short term lease lasts less than a year (normally one month to six months), but some businesses may define short-term leases as continuing two or three years.
As with standard monthly leases, all details regarding additional fees and deposits must be contained in the lease. For vacation rentals, common added charges may originate from resort taxes and cleaning fees. Additional charges can also be incurred at the property for pets or other people, stays beyond the checkout time, telephone use and property damage. Booking deposit or a damage deposit is a lease requirement to hold the property. Terms for the return of a damage deposit should be spelled out. Total payment for the vacation rental is required before the arrival date--sometimes up to 30 days before check in.
Among the elements of a flexible lease arrangement is a shorter period. Many of these lease arrangements go on a month-to-month basis. This implies you could stay in the property for one month at a time. If at the end of the month you decide that you want to move out, you can move out without any fees. If you needed to with this arrangement, you could also stay in the property for a long period.

Be careful not to price yourself out of the market when you establish the rent for your furnished apartment. You may not have the ability to rent the apartment to anyone, if you set the rent too high. You might be better off to sell or keep them and rent the apartment unfurnished if you are concerned about your furnishings. In general, you should establish the rent based on your expenses to possess and keep the property, including the furnishings, plus your desired rate of return on your own investment. Vacation rental leases limit the number of adults, kids, and pets--and some even prohibit kids or pets. If additional guests are permitted at all, this provision is included in the lease, commonly with a note of an additional cost. A minimum stay must be paid whether or not the vacationers remain for the complete duration and is, in addition, usually included in the rent.
One of the possible drawbacks of using a variable lease arrangement is that the rent may be higher. Since landlords are giving up the stability that comes with a long-term, fixed contract, they need to charge you a little bit more cash. This sort of contract can be advantageous, if you're willing to pay for this extra freedom and flexibility. You may want to give to a longer, given duration should you be all about saving money.
The utilities in the flat can be an issue, when using a flexible lease arrangement. It may be difficult to get the utilities set your name, if you plan on being in the flat for just a short time. In this situation, you may need to locate an apartment landlord who offers services as part of the rent. Many lease agreements that are adaptive supply utilities included, and it can be a great deal more suitable to go this route. You may also save money because you only need to pay the rent monthly.
When renting a furnished apartment to protect your investment, it is wise to provide the tenant with an itemized list of the items contained in the flat lease. Be really particular; list the amount of plates, bowls, and cups, as an example, and describe items as accurately as possible. List the replacement cost of each thing if the piece is taken by the tenant with him when he moves out, or if it's damaged beyond ordinary wear and tear. Indicate if the replacement cost will be required out of the security deposit, or if the renter will have to pay you directly for the things. Have so there are not any surprises when the lease comes to a finish the tenant sign a copy of this stock.

If you rent a house or flat that is furnished, whether it contains merely some basic furniture or is fully furnished with furniture, linens, electronics, and accessories, you can bill renters rent that is higher. You'd to buy the things which are furnishing the house, and will have to replace those things if they are damaged or ruined. Those costs will be recouped by a higher monthly rent. It is up to you as the landlord to decide how much more you need to charge for the furnishings, but generally the increased cost will be based by owners on style and the state of the furnishings. For instance, a property that includes a brand new, modern living room set is worth more than one that contains pieces that are mismatched with frayed seams.
In addition to or instead of a higher rent for a furnished flat, you could request a higher security deposit on the rental. Collecting more cash up front can assist you to cover the costs of replacing or repairing the things in the furnished flat if they are damaged. Check with your state laws before collecting the security deposit, however. Some states have laws controlling what landlords can charge and security deposits. Should you not wish to contain it in the security deposit, you could also charge a different cleaning fee for the lease, to cover the costs of cleaning furniture, bedding, drapes and other items.
Strategies change. Someone gets sick and can't make the trip. There's a hurricane at the vacation destination. A flight is canceled by an airline. The cancellation policy is an essential component of any vacation lease. It should explain any deadlines associated with the removal, the conditions under which a cancellation can be made, and the associated fees.

When negotiating a flexible lease arrangement, you have to pay attention to how much you're paying in deposits. He might expect you to pay just a little bit more in deposits, since the landlord thinks that you might only be in the property for a brief time. If a higher down payment doesn't bill, you could easily damage the property and move out without any repercussions. This helps keep the landlord safe even if it does take more money from your pocket upfront.

Should be included in the lease, including phone usage, garbage, laundry, housekeeping, and parking. Occasionally, discretionary services are available, like daily housekeeping services along with cleaning upon departure. These should be, at a minimum, recorded on the lease in case the vacationers choose to make use of the service after they arrive. Expectancies about the utilization of the property should also be clearly indicated--either in the lease or via a procedures guide referenced in the contract. Who cleans the grill? Who takes the garbage out and where does it go? Should the sheets be stripped by the vacationers or by housekeeping? Must the dishes be washed before housekeeping arrives? These are all issues which should be addressed avert battles over the stay and the lease and to ensure a smooth vacation.
In between the group of individuals who own vacation homes or timeshares, and the group who stay at hotels and motor hotels, is a public that's found the middle ground by leading vacation rentals by month, week or the weekend. Whether you desire to hire one or own a vacation rental, it's important to protect yourself with a contract that clearly lays out the duties and duties of all parties.
Times and the dates of arrival and departure are spelled out in great specificity in the vacation rental lease. Vacationers are coming and going every week--sometimes every few days--and the units must be cleaned between stays. To prevent vacancy between stays, the time between check in and checkout is typically a comparatively short window. And because some vacationers rely on air transportation, there are sometimes last minute requests to arrive or depart early or late. It is, therefore, important to contain eventuality requests in the lease, signifying both a price and a procedure to shift agreed upon plans.
